This is well known and actually not a bug. The point is that these units are actually US units and they spawn when you DoW Vichy France. They can only activate once USA joins the Allies. Neutral country units can't move. It's the same with USSR units that can't move until Barbarossa starts.
The Free French units will be able to move once USA is in the war.

In RC9 we changed the rail rules so you can only rail if you're adjacent to a city or a resource (like a rail depot). Before you could rail from any hex if you weren't adjacent to an enemy unit and in supply level 3 or more.Kragdob wrote:Installed RC11. Started new game (Single Player) - 1939 scenario.
